Deal at Travel Inn Site is Off
As many of you know, there had been a church interested in building a sanctuary and campus at the site of the old Travel Inn. This deal has just ended. City Council Approves Stone Master Plan
Greenville City Council voted yesterday evening to approve the Stone Avenue Master Plan in principle. This means that they have approved the overall goals, guidelines and strategies laid out in the plan.
